
当 TP 钱包无法授权登录时,表面是一个按钮失效,内里却牵连着区块生成、签名流程、网络节点与本地权限的复杂生态。要把问题从现象拆解为本质,需同时审视链端与客户端、协议层与用户习惯。

首先看区块生成与链状态。若节点不同步或发生链重组、区块拥堵,钱包在等待交易或签名确认时可能超时或报错;RPC 提供者波动、区块高度跳变、nonce 不连贯都会导致“无法授权”类异常。其次是多功能数字钱包本身的权限与模块耦合:DApp 授权、合约批准、跨链桥接、硬件签名接口任一环节受阻,都会阻断登录流程;老版本客户端、缓存损坏或签名算法不匹配(如 EIP-191/712 变体)亦是常见原因。
私密交易记录既是隐私需求也是排错要点。现代钱包通常在本地加密存储交易历史并与链上状态核对;若本地索引损坏或同步策略失败,用户会看到不一致而误判为“授权失败”。对隐私友好的技术(如零知识证明、混币服务或链下隐私层)在提高匿名性的同时会让常规的鉴权与回溯更加复杂,因此在排障时需注意隐私层是否阻塞了标准签名验证流程。
交易加速层面,卡顿或挂起的旧交易会占用 nonce,阻止新交易签名或提交。实用的解决路径包括使用替换交易(RBF/EIP-1559 提速)、选择更稳定的 RPC 节点或通过矿工/加速服务提交更高费用的替换单。此外,多签或阈值签名的钱包需要协调在线参与者,这又增加了登录与授权的脆弱点。
把视线投向前沿:分片、Layer2 rollup、zk-proofs、MPC 与账户抽象正在重塑授权逻辑。它们能缓解区块拥堵、提高隐私并支持无需私钥的元交易(meta-transactions),但也要求钱包与 dApp 更新认证交互协议与错误提示,才能让用户在故障出现时有迹可循。
综合专业建议是:逐步排查——切换 RPC、检查链与 nonce、清空缓存或重装、确认应用权限、尝试替换交易或使用硬件钱包;对私密性强的用户,优先保留种子与离线签名、谨慎使用混合隐私工具。开发者层面应改善错误可读性、增强重试与降级策略,并拥抱标准化的元交易与账户抽象,以把复杂性从用户界面抽离。
当技术变得更前沿,用户体验也应更平滑;在这一演进期,既要理解区块的节奏https://www.xztstc.com ,,也要守护那一串私钥与用户信任。
评论
Ethan88
写得很全面,尤其是关于nonce和RBF的部分,很实用。
小米酱
我就碰到过RPC波动导致授权失败,按文中方法切换节点解决了。
CryptoCat
能不能再写一篇针对硬件钱包与多签的具体排错流程?很需要。
赵无极
关于隐私层的影响讲得到位,之前用zk工具后确实出现过授权异常。
Luna
文章语言很好,通俗又不失专业,收藏了。
阿飞
建议增加一些图示或流程图,帮助非技术用户理解步骤。